Cod sursa(job #3041499)
| Utilizator | Data | 31 martie 2023 16:17:53 | |
|---|---|---|---|
| Problema | Datorii | Scor | 0 |
| Compilator | cpp-64 | Status | done |
| Runda | Arhiva de probleme | Marime | 0.63 kb |
#include <bits/stdc++.h>
using namespace std;
ifstream in("datorii.in");
ofstream out("datorii.out");
int N, M, a[15001];
int main()
{
in>>N>>M;
for(int i=1; i<=N; i++){
in>>a[i];
}
for(int i=1, cod; i<=M; i++){
in>>cod;
if(cod==0)
{
int t, v;
in>>t>>v;
a[t]-=v;
}
else if(cod==1)
{
int p, q;
int suma=0;
in>>p>>q;
for(int j=p; j<=q; j++){
suma+=a[j];
}
out<<suma<<'\n';
}
}
return 0;
}
